Lake Grivița

Reservoir in Sector , Bucharest
44°29′51″N 26°02′48″E / 44.497485°N 26.046714°E / 44.497485; 26.046714TypereservoirPrimary inflowsColentina RiverPrimary outflowsColentina RiverBasin countriesRomaniaMax. length3.8 km (2.4 mi)Max. width500 m (1,600 ft)Surface area53 ha (130 acres)Max. depth5 m (16 ft)Water volume1,000,000 m3 (810 acre⋅ft)

Lake Grivița is an anthropic lake located in the northern part of the city of Bucharest, developed on the Colentina River, in the area where it flows through the urban area of the city, situated between Lake Străulești upstream and Lake Băneasa downstream.[1][2]
